RE: The tariff classification of insulated lunch bags from China

Dear Mr. Cullen:

In your letter dated February 9, 2012, you requested a tariff classification ruling. Your samples will be returned to you.

Style 882278 is a soft-sided insulated lunch bag constructed with an outer surface of polyester textile material. The lunch bag is designed to provide storage, protection, organization, and portability to food and beverages during travel. It is also designed to maintain the temperature of food and beverages. The bag has an interior storage compartment lined with aluminum foil that is laminated to a layer of foam plastic. The top of the bag has a zipper closure along three sides and carrying handle at the top. The front exterior has an open mesh pocket. It measures approximately 10" (W) x 7" (H) x 4.5" (D).

Style 882279 is a soft-sided insulated lunch bag constructed with an outer surface of polyester textile material. The lunch bag is designed to provide storage, protection, organization, and portability to food and beverages during travel. It is also designed to maintain the temperature of food and beverages. The bag has an interior storage compartment lined with aluminum foil that is laminated to a layer of foam plastic. The bag has a small flap which secures with a hook-and-loop closure and a carrying handle at the top. It measures approximately 7.5” (W) x 9.5” (H) x 2.5” (D).

The applicable subheading for both lunch bags will be 4202.92.0807,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S), which provides for insulated food and beverage bags, with outer surface of textile materials, other, of man-made fibers. The duty rate will be 7% ad valorem.
